The polar bear is found in the Arctic Circle and the nearby islands. They can be found in good numbers in Alaska, Norway, Denmark, Russia and Canada. There are smaller populations in the surrounding regions near the Arctic pole. They prefer the Cold Icy areas of the Arctic and thrive in areas where the human intervention is minimal. They are found in good numbers in areas where their primary prey, the Seals mate and nest.

How did polar bears get to Svalbard?

Polar bears likely arrived in Svalbard by drifting on sea ice from neighboring areas like Greenland or Russia. They are excellent swimmers and can cover long distances in search of food or new territory. The unique ecosystem of Svalbard provides suitable habitat for polar bears, hence they established a population on the islands.
